No Hunting Here, Please No Hunting Here, Please is an essay by Denise D. Knight that first appeared on 5th of October 1998 in Newsweek, Vol.132 Issue 14, on p16.It is an essay that focuses on her life and that of her husband by the countryside. They built a dream house and made the environment conducive for wild animals to stay. They also put “NO HUNTING” signs all over the property so as to protect these animals from potential hunters. However to their disappointment, hunters trespassed inspite of the clear warning signs.

Knight in this essay exposes the ruthlessness that is exhibited by New York hunters who kill these animals with impunity and lack respect for people’s property. Knight laments, “Then they take to the woods, often with willful disregard for posted signs on private land. Although the state has thousands of acres of land open to hunters, many of them seek out the less crowded conditions found on private property”(Knight, 1998).This impunity cuts across the board from the aged to the young, from parents to children.

The police have also been complacent and the fines imposed are not punitive enough to deter the hunters to keep off from other people’s property. Knight basically wants us to focus on the disturbances as well as dangers caused by hunters who intrude on an individual’s private property, New York State’s lack of control over hunters where she lives, occurrences of hunters blatantly disregarding “no hunting” signs clearly posted on people’s property and most importantly the fact that trespassing is a serious sign of similar social illness which misleads some people to think that the law cannot touch them, since they are above it (Knight, 1998).
